What are Optical Systems Engineers?

Optical Systems Engineers are professionals who design, develop, and optimize systems that use light, such as cameras, telescopes, lasers, and fiber optic communication devices. They apply principles of optics, physics, and engineering to create solutions for imaging, sensing, and transmitting information. Their work often involves selecting components, modeling optical performance, and collaborating with multidisciplinary teams to integrate optical technologies into larger systems. Optical Systems Engineers are essential in industries like aerospace, telecommunications, medical devices, and consumer electronics.

What is the difference between Optical Systems Engineer vs Optical Design Engineer?

AspectOptical Systems EngineerOptical Design Engineer
Required CredentialsBachelor's or Master's in Optical Engineering, Physics, or related fields; often certifications in optical designBachelor's or Master's in Optical Engineering, Physics, or related fields; certifications in optical design software
Work EnvironmentResearch labs, manufacturing, R&D departments, often cross-disciplinary teamsDesign studios, R&D labs, manufacturing, focused on optical component and system design
Employer & Industry UsageOptical, aerospace, defense, telecommunications, imaging industriesOptical, consumer electronics, aerospace, defense, medical devices

Optical Systems Engineers focus on integrating optical components into complete systems, ensuring functionality and performance. Optical Design Engineers primarily develop and optimize individual optical components and assemblies. Both roles require strong optical knowledge, but their focus differs from system integration to component design.

What are the key skills and qualifications needed to thrive as an Optical Systems Engineer, and why are they important?

To thrive as an Optical Systems Engineer, you need strong knowledge in optics, physics, and engineering principles, typically supported by a degree in optical engineering or a related field. Familiarity with optical design software (such as Zemax or Code V), CAD tools, and laboratory measurement instruments is often required. Attention to detail, analytical thinking, and effective communication are valuable soft skills for collaborating with multidisciplinary teams and solving complex problems. These skills and qualifications ensure precise system design, efficient troubleshooting, and successful project outcomes in the development of advanced optical technologies.

Description

SAIC is actively seeking a Laser Optical Engineer to join our dynamic team of physicists, biologists, optometrists, engineers, and technicians dedicated to conducting fundamental and applied research in the realm of laser bio-effects and safety within military environments. This full-time position is in support of the Optical Radiation Safety and Bioeffects research program based at the Air Force Research Laboratory in San Antonio, Texas.

RESPONSIBILITIES:

  • Operate, repair, and maintain a variety of laser systems ranging from ultrafast to multi-kilowatt CW lasers, ultraviolet through far-infrared wavelengths.
  • Design and construct optical systems to deliver laser energy to specified targets that satisfy costumer defined specifications.
  • Develop electronic and optoelectronic control systems for precise delivery of laser energy.
  • Perform laser beam characterization and dosimetry.
  • Generate documentation on equipment operation and maintenance.
  • Generate documentation on optical system components, laser calibration and alignment procedures.
  • Provide training to other engineers.

Qualifications

  • US Citizenship required. Must be willing and able to obtain a Secret clearance.
  • Proficient in troubleshooting, component replacement, and calibration of lasers according to vendor specifications.
  • Bachelor's degree & 5 years relevant experience, OR Master's degree & 3 years of relevant experience.
  • Experience in developing LabView virtual instruments desirable.
  • Ability to build optical systems per costumer defined specifications.
  • Ability to collaborate effectively in cross-functional teams with program managers, scientists, and engineers for experiment development and execution.
  • Experience working with external suppliers to ensure timely delivery of critical optical hardware.
  • Strong written and verbal communication skills.
